AN APPEAL FOR THE CHILDREN.
Church of England Homes in tha Wellington diocese' care' for lome 250 children, ranging from .babies at St. Barnabas' Home, Khandallah,/to girl 3 of all ages at St. 'Mary's Homes,"Karori, and boys at Lower Hutt-and Masterton. Homes. There is. also AU-.Sain.ts-' Home at Palmerstori North,, taking, both girls and boys. Annual charges for this work exceed £7000, and almost £6000 must be found from sources other than maintenance fees.- To assist in the work a street, day on behalf of the homes, is being held, in Wellington tomorrow and an appeal is made to the public to give generously so. 'that those who are performing this valuable Christian social service may be supported and help to brighten the lives of the little ones at Christmas.
